Qori Ismaris[edit]

Medium humanoid (gnoll, shapechanger), chaotic evil


Armor Class 15 (natural armor)
Hit Points 112 (15d8 + 45)
Speed 40 ft.


STR DEX CON INT WIS CHA
18 (+4) 14 (+2) 16 (+3) 12 (+1) 12 (+1) 16 (+3)

Saving Throws Str +7, Con +6, Cha +6
Skills Arcana +4, Deception +9, Insight +4, Investigation +4, Perception +7, Stealth +8
Proficiency Bonus +3
Damage Immunities bludgeoning, piercing, and slashing damage from nonmagical attacks that aren't silvered
Senses darkvision 60 ft., passive Perception 17
Languages Common, Gnoll, any two languages
Challenge 6 (2,300 XP)


Shapechanger. The qori ismaris can use its action to polymorph into a hyena-humanoid hybrid, a humanoid, a hyena, a Large or smaller beast with CR less than or equal to its own, or back into its true form, which is a gnoll. Its statistics, other than its size, are the same in each form. Any equipment it is wearing or carrying isn't transformed.

Keen Hearing and Smell. The qori ismaris has advantage on Wisdom (Perception) checks that rely on hearing or smell.

Pounce (Gnoll, Hyena or Hybrid Form Only). If the qori ismaris moves at least 15 feet straight toward a creature and then hits it with a claw attack on the same turn, that target must succeed on a DC 15 Strength saving throw or be knocked prone. If the target is prone, the qori ismaris can make one bite attack against it as a bonus action.

Innate Spellcasting. The qori ismaris's innate spellcasting ability is Charisma (spell save DC 14). The qori ismaris can innately cast the following spells, requiring no material components:

At will: faerie fire, invisibility, mending, mirror image, see invisibility
3/day each: charm person, heat metal, sleep, vampiric touch

Regeneration. The qori ismaris regains 10 hit points at the start of its turn if it has at least 1 hit point. If the qori ismaris takes bludgeoning, piercing or slashing damage from a magical or silvered attack, this trait doesn't function at the start of the qori ismaris's next turn.

ACTIONS

Multiattack. The qori ismaris makes three attacks in gnoll, hyena or hybrid form: one with its bite and two with its claws or flail in gnoll or hybrid form. In humanoid form, it makes two attacks with its flail. In beast form, it makes two maul attacks.

Bite (Gnoll, Hyena or Hybrid Form Only). Melee Weapon Attack: +7 to hit, reach 5 ft., one target. Hit: 9 (1d10 + 4) piercing damage. If the target is a hyena, it must succeed on a DC 14 Constitution saving throw or be transformed into a bouda over the next 1d4 hours.
A spell such as lesser restoration or remove curse can end the transformation process at any time before it runs its course. After the process is complete, only a wish spell can reverse the effect.

Claws (Gnoll, Hyena or Hybrid Form Only). Melee Weapon Attack: +7 to hit, reach 5 ft., one creature. Hit: 9 (2d4 + 4) slashing damage.

Maul (Beast Form Only). Melee Weapon Attack: +7 to hit, reach 5 ft., one creature. Hit: 13 (2d8 + 4) bludgeoning damage as a Large beast, 8 (1d8 + 4) bludgeoning damage as a Medium or Small beast or 1 bludgeoning damage as a Tiny beast.

Flail (Gnoll, Humanoid or Hybrid Form Only). Melee Weapon Attack: +7 to hit, reach 5 ft., one target. Hit: 8 (1d8 + 4) bludgeoning damage.

BONUS ACTIONS

Rampage. When the qori ismaris reduces a creature to 0 hit points with a melee attack on its turn, the qori ismaris moves up to half its speed and makes a bite attack.

The qori ismaris are gnolls transformed by the malign will of Yeenoghu into powerful shapeshifters known to haunt the savannah and arid highlands but they have been spotted in the rainforests as well. It is said that they will take up residence near villages as handsome blacksmiths and lovely healers and slowly manipulate the village into trusting them, all the while feeding information to a gnoll pack and subtly weakening the defenders. Over time, the qori ismaris will transform any nearby hyenas into boudas and task them with murdering and impersonating some of the villagers, who become the qori's loyal lackeys and enforcers. Once the other gnolls arrive, the qori ismaris and the boudas reveal their allegiance and strike and devour their prey in their true form.
